“Se Amar Mon Kereche” (English: He/She Stole My Heart) is a Bengali romantic action film released in 2012. Directed by Sohanur Rahman Sohan, the film features a talented cast and a soundtrack that added to its appeal.

Cast:

  • Shakib Khan
  • Srabosti Dutta Tinni
  • Alamgir
  • Misha Sawdagor
  • Ahmed Sharif
  • Prabir Mitra
  • Rehana Jolly
  • Afzal Sharif

Music: The film’s music was directed by Showkat Ali Emon, and it featured a variety of talented singers such as Endru Kishore, Kumar Bishwajit, Rezia Parvin, and Kanak Chapa.
